The Neitzel dragon fruit (often spelled 'Niezel') is a self-pollinating, white-fleshed variety known for its sweet, appealing flavor with a lemony tang and granular texture. It is a selection made by the California Rare Fruit Growers. 

Characteristics and Growing Information

  • Flesh and Flavor: The fruit has firm, bright white flesh with a sweet, lemony flavor (Brix around 22) and a slightly granular texture.
  • Fruit Size: Fruits are generally considered medium to large, often weighing between 0.75 to 1.25 pounds. My plant produce fruit up to 2lbs.
  • Plant Details: It is a self-pollinating variety, which means it can set fruit without cross-pollination from another genetic type. The plant itself is a fast-growing, vining cactus that climbs using aerial roots and produces large, fragrant, night-blooming white flowers.
  • Growing Conditions: Neitzel plants are adaptable but thrive in well-drained, organic cactus mix with full sun exposure (6-8+ hours). They are best suited for USDA zones 10-11 and should be protected from frost.
